Transaction e62a2239464f1a7e041b760756c6cf96415ed21d4e6b555c323524a0c86eda81
1 Input
1 Output
-
e62a2239464f1a7e041b760756c6cf96415ed21d4e6b555c323524a0c86eda81:0
- value
- 14077837
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 22daaeef3f1258d588f74969660defeae17c164b OP_EQUALVERIFY OP_CHECKSIG
- address
- 14BHwubxC3CB9Gh5YQaKkEwdd6LJVYdEzk